الفرق بين المراجعتين لصفحة: «HTML/map»

من موسوعة حسوب
ط استبدال النص - ':(Content sectioning|Edits|Embedded content|Forms|Inline text semantics|Input Types|Interactive elements|Main Root|Metadata|Multimedia|Scripting|Table|Text Content)' ب':HTML $1'
ط استبدال النص - '\[\[تصنيف:(.*)\]\]' ب'{{SUBPAGENAME}}'
سطر 60: سطر 60:
*مواصفة [http://www.w3.org/TR/html5/embedded-content-0.html#the-map-element HTML5].
*مواصفة [http://www.w3.org/TR/html5/embedded-content-0.html#the-map-element HTML5].
*مواصفة [http://www.w3.org/TR/html401/struct/objects.html#h-13.6.1 HTML 4.01].
*مواصفة [http://www.w3.org/TR/html401/struct/objects.html#h-13.6.1 HTML 4.01].
[[تصنيف:HTML]]
[[تصنيف:HTML|{{SUBPAGENAME}}]]
[[تصنيف:HTML Elements]]
[[تصنيف:HTML Elements|{{SUBPAGENAME}}]]
[[تصنيف:HTML Multimedia]]
[[تصنيف:HTML Multimedia|{{SUBPAGENAME}}]]

مراجعة 15:41، 28 يناير 2018

يُستخدَم العنصر <map> مع عنصر <area> لتعريف خريطة للصورة (أي منطقة قابلة للنقر في الصورة).

مثال عن استخدام العنصر <map> باسم primary لتعريف خريطة تتألف من دائرتين (عبر العنصر <area>) تشير كلُ واحدةٍ منهما إلى صفحة أخرى، ثم استخدام تلك الخريطة عبر عنصر <img> باستخدام الخاصية usemap:

<map name="primary">
  <area shape="circle" coords="75,75,75" href="left.html">
  <area shape="circle" coords="275,75,75" href="right.html">
</map>
<img usemap="#primary" src="http://placehold.it/350x150" alt="350 x 150 pic">

إذا جرّبتَ المثال السابق، واستخدمت زر tab في لوحة مفاتيحك فستشاهد شيئًا شبيهًا بما يلي:

المنطقة الأولى في خريطة صورة
رابط لصفحة left.html
المنطقة الثانية في خريطة صورة
رابط لصفحة right.html
تصنيفات المحتوى عنصر تنظيمي أو عنصر عادي.
المحتوى المسموح أي عنصر له خلفية شفافة.
الوسم المختصر لا يمكن حذف أيّ من وسمَي البداية أو النهاية.
العناصر الأب أي عنصر يقبل المحتوى العادي.
واجهة DOM HTMLMapElement

دعم المتصفحات

Chrome Firefox Edge Safari Opera
مدعوم مدعوم مدعوم مدعوم مدعوم

الخاصيات

يمكن استخدام الخاصيات العامة في هذا العنصر.

name

تُعطي هذه الخاصية الخريطة اسمًا لكي نتمكن من الإشارة إليها.

يجب أن تكون هذه الخاصية موجودةً ويجب أن يكون لها قيمةٌ غيرُ فارغةٍ وألّا تحتوي على فراغات؛ ولا يجوز أنَ تكون قيمتها مساويةً لقيمة الخاصية name لعنصر <map> آخر في المستند.

إذا حُدِّدَت قيمة للخاصية id فيجب أن تكون قيمتها وقيمة هذه الخاصية متساوية.

مصادر ومواصفات